Pokey's Hat


So I was wanting to add a pattern to Ravelry but then I realized that I need a website or pdf link - neither of which I had so I am going to recreate it here. Giving it away for free on Ravelry is no different than posting it for all to see here, is it. So here goes, Pokey's Hat pattern:



Materials:
- 4 oz of Worsted Weight yarn
- size 9 needles (straight or circular)
- size 9 double pointed needles (optional)
- tapestry needle
-stitch marker (if using circular needles)

Cast on 87 stitches (if you need it larger, work in increments of 9)

Row 1: *k2, p2* to end of the row
Row 2: purl the knits and knit the purls to end of row
Repeat this until work measures 1.5” to 2” from finished edge.

Beginning with WS, knit entire row. Work in Stockinet stitch until completed work measures 8” from finished edge.

Decrease: Begin decreasing by *k 8, k2tog* repeat to end of row. Next row, decrease by *k 7, k2tog* repeat to end of row. Continue all the way to *k2tog, k2tog* and you have 8 stitches on your needles. Pull remaining stitches back through with yarn on tapestry needle. Pull tight and knot off, weaving through six stitches to secure tail.

For a nice variation, you could do a seed stitch (k1, p1) instead of the 2x2 ribbing. Photo shows a seed stitch edge.
